Largest Available Gibbs and Nearby 3 Bedroom Apartments

The largest available 3 Bedroom apartment unit in Gibbs, MO is found at CROSS CREEK VILLAS in the The Links of Columbia neighborhood and is 2,000 square feet priced from $1,599. Manor Homes has the second largest 3 Bedroom, which is sized at 1,750 square feet and currently listed start at $1,800. Here is today’s list of the largest available 3 Bedroom units in Gibbs:

Cheapest Available Gibbs and Nearby 3 Bedroom Apartments

As of May 11, 2025 the lowest priced 3 Bedroom apartment unit in Gibbs, MO is the Three Bedroom Model starting from $845 at Louden Lofts . The second most affordable Gibbs 3 Bedroom is the 3BR/3BA - Hampton Model at Element Communities Downtown Columbia - Hi... starting at $939 in the Tiger Village Apartments neighborhood. The average price for all 3 Bedroom apartments in Gibbs is currently $1,391.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 3 Bedroom options in Gibbs:
